Takahashi Character Analysis
Takahashi is a character from the Anime series "Ajin: Demi-Human". Takahashi is a supporting character in the series and plays a significant role in the development of the main character, Kei Nagai. Takahashi is portrayed as a gentle and compassionate person who is always there to help others in need, but he is also a fierce fighter who is ready to stand up for what he believes in. In the series, Takahashi is one of the first people who discover that Kei is an Ajin, a rare breed of immortal beings. He becomes a mentor and friend to Kei, helping him to understand his new powers and teaching him how to survive in a world that is bent on destroying Ajin. As the two become close, Takahashi becomes an important figure in Kei's life, helping him to overcome his fears and become a stronger person. Takahashi is also a skilled fighter who is never afraid to go head to head with the countless enemies that come their way. He takes on some of the toughest opponents in the series and is often seen as a fearless warrior who will stop at nothing to protect his friends. With his speed and strength, Takahashi is a formidable force in the series, and his fights are always intense and exciting. Ultimately, Takahashi is a beloved character in "Ajin: Demi-Human" who plays a crucial role in the series. His unwavering loyalty to his friends, his genuine concern for others, and his fierce fighting skills make him a memorable character who is cherished by fans of the series.
